Security forces advance towards Mullaitivu, Mannar
by Dhaneshi Yatawara
[email protected]
Security forces advancing in the Forward Defence Lines of the Wanni
front are closing in towards Thunukkai and Mallavi in the Mullaitivu
district and with another thrust towards Vellankulam in Mannar, military
sources said.
Troops of the 57 Division under the command of Major General Jagath
Dias are heading towards the Thunukkai and Mallavi areas.
Towards the Western coastal line, troops of the 58 Division led by
Brigadier Shavindra Silva, are marching forward towards Vellankulam,
approximately 10 kms from Iluppaikadawal.
Most areas in the vicinity of the Vavunikulam tank are under the
total control of the security forces.
In the Mannar district, three kilometres from Vellankulam is the
border of the Kilinochchi district.
“We have observed an eight kilometres long earth bund six kilometres
south of Vellankulam. The troops have targeted to cause maximum cadre
loss to the LTTE,” Brig. Shavindra Silva said.
According to ground information, it is possible that the LTTE might
use its maximum effort to hold on to these territories due to its
strategic importance.
By Friday troops of the 57 Division recovered 33 LTTE dead bodies. A
120mm artillery gun and a 81mm mortar gun were recovered along with a
haul of weapons and ammunition in the aftermath of the battle to rescue
the Vavunikulam tank. |
